Output 58c8424debbf37c650250332b95decfd17d54dfe6dbc1976437f398f85be7748:1

value
300994
script pubkey
OP_0 OP_PUSHBYTES_20 f38e2162eb12f30cdd4d98a778e8321c346233c4
address
bc1q7w8zzchtzteseh2dnznh36pjrs6xyv7y0aexqu
transaction
58c8424debbf37c650250332b95decfd17d54dfe6dbc1976437f398f85be7748
spent
true